Что такое SQL и как с ним работать

Что такое SQL и как с ним оперировать
13 Mayıs 2026
Что такое VPN и как он действует
13 Mayıs 2026

Что такое SQL и как с ним работать

Что такое SQL и как с ним работать

SQL представляет собой язык упорядоченных запросов для обработки данными в реляционных базах данных. Средство позволяет формировать таблицы, добавлять записи, изменять сведения и стирать лишнюю информацию. SQL применяют программисты, аналитики, операторы баз данных и тестировщики.

Язык действует через операторы, которые посылаются системе управления базами данных. Операторы оформляются текстом по определённым стандартам синтаксиса. Система получает инструкцию, исполняет запрос и предоставляет ответ.

Деятельность с SQL начинается с познания фундаментальных операторов для выборки и корректировки сведений. Неопытные изучают инструкции SELECT, INSERT, UPDATE и DELETE. Опыт деятельности с admiral x помогает зафиксировать знания и постичь логику построения запросов.

SQL отличается описательным методом к программированию. Пользователь обозначает требуемый результат, а система автономно устанавливает способ выполнения действия. Данный способ облегчает написание инструкций для неопытных работников.

Для чего нужен SQL

SQL используется для хранения и обработки организованной данных в коммерческих и некоммерческих разработках. Язык предоставляет быстрый соединение к миллионам записей и обеспечивает возможность осуществлять исследовательские операции над сведениями.

Веб-магазины задействуют SQL для администрирования перечнями товаров, обработки покупок и фиксации запасов. Финансовые системы сохраняют данные о заказчиках, операциях и балансах в реляционных базах. Социальные ресурсы применяют инструмент для взаимодействия с аккаунтами пользователей и постами.

Аналитики admiral x извлекают данные из баз для генерации документов и определения паттернов. SQL даёт возможность агрегировать метрики, определять усреднённые величины и объединять информацию по критериям. Маркетологи изучают активность клиентов с через инструкций к базам данных.

Программисты формируют сервисы, которые взаимодействуют с базами через SQL. Веб-сервисы отправляют запросы для приёма информации и показа контента. Мобильные сервисы синхронизируют данные с серверами.

Как устроены базы данных и таблицы

База данных представляет собой структурированное хранилище данных, включающее из взаимосвязанных таблиц. Каждая таблица включает данные об конкретной сущности: потребителях, продуктах, заказах или транзакциях. Организация базы разрабатывается с соблюдением коммерческих требований и особенностей предметной отрасли.

Таблица образуется из записей и полей, повторяя компьютерную таблицу. Столбцы устанавливают параметры объектов и называются полями. Строки имеют конкретные записи с сведениями об отдельных элементах сущности. Каждое поле обладает установленный вид данных: численный, текстовый, дата или двоичный.

Главный ключ однозначно выделяет каждую элемент в таблице. Обычно основным ключом становится численное поле с эксклюзивными значениями. Вторичные ключи формируют отношения между таблицами и поддерживают непротиворечивость сведений в базе.

Ключевые компоненты организации таблицы включают:

  • Имя таблицы, представляющее содержащуюся элемент
  • Перечень полей с определением видов данных
  • Ограничения для проверки точности вносимой данных
  • Индексы для оптимизации извлечения строк

Нормализация базы данных исключает повторение данных и группирует информацию по категориальным таблицам. Процедура нормализации следует конкретным принципам, обозначаемым нормальными формами. Грамотная архитектура адмирал х облегчает сопровождение и улучшает эффективность системы.

Диаграмма базы данных графически показывает таблицы и соединения между ними. Схемы помогают понять структуру организации данных и спроектировать оптимальную организацию. Работа с admiral x требует знания основ построения реляционных схем данных.

Главные команды для деятельности с информацией

SELECT выбирает сведения из таблиц базы данных. Инструкция обеспечивает возможность определить необходимые столбцы и критерии выборки данных. Команда выдаёт итог в виде совокупности элементов, удовлетворяющих критериям инструкции.

INSERT включает дополнительные строки в таблицу. Инструкция предполагает определения имени таблицы и параметров для ввода полей. Можно включить единственную строку или ряд записей за одну операцию. Система контролирует согласованность сведений видам полей перед вставкой.

UPDATE корректирует наличествующие строки в таблице. Команда даёт возможность обновить величины одного или нескольких полей. Параметр WHERE задаёт, какие строки подлежат изменению. Без указания параметра оператор модифицирует все строки в таблице.

DELETE устраняет строки из таблицы по установленному условию. Команда навсегда уничтожает информацию, поэтому нуждается осторожного употребления. Критерий WHERE задаёт, какие записи необходимо удалить.

CREATE TABLE генерирует дополнительную таблицу с заданной организацией полей. Инструкция указывает названия полей, форматы данных и условия. DROP TABLE полностью уничтожает таблицу вместе со всем наполнением. Познание admiral-x формирует основные компетенции управления сведениями в реляционных механизмах сохранения.

Отбор, сортировка и группировка строк

Условие WHERE отбирает записи по установленным критериям. Инструкция даёт возможность извлечь строки, соответствующие определённым величинам полей. Можно использовать операторы сопоставления и логические действия AND, OR, NOT для формирования сложных параметров. Фильтрация снижает объём выдаваемых сведений.

ORDER BY организует результаты выборки по единственному или нескольким столбцам. Оператор обеспечивает сортировку по росту и снижению параметров. Упорядочивание записей облегчает анализ данных и нахождение нужных величин.

GROUP BY объединяет записи с идентичными параметрами в указанных полях. Группировка задействуется параллельно с суммирующими функциями для расчёта итоговых метрик. Методы COUNT, SUM, AVG, MIN и MAX определяют численность строк, итоги, средние параметры, минимумы и наибольшие значения.

HAVING выбирает результаты после объединения сведений. Параметр используется к объединённым величинам и обеспечивает возможность отобрать совокупности, отвечающие конкретным критериям по вычисленным величинам.

Операторы LIKE и IN увеличивают способности выборки строк. LIKE выполняет нахождение по шаблону с масочными знаками. IN анализирует наличие значения в набор опций. Корректное применение адмирал х улучшает производительность исследовательских запросов.

Как соединяются данные из множественных таблиц

JOIN связывает данные из множества таблиц на основе соединений между ними. Действие позволяет извлечь информацию, размещённую по различным таблицам, в одном финальном комплекте. Соединение формируется через совместные поля, обычно первичный и внешний ключи.

INNER JOIN возвращает исключительно те записи, для которых найдены совпадения в обеих таблицах. Элементы без соответствия устраняются из итога. Этот вид соединения применяется, когда требуются данные, присутствующие одновременно в взаимосвязанных таблицах.

LEFT JOIN включает все записи из левой таблицы и соответствующие элементы из правой. Если пересечение отсутствует, колонки правой таблицы заполняются величинами NULL. Команда применяется для получения полного списка строк из основной таблицы.

RIGHT JOIN работает обратным способом, сохраняя все элементы правой таблицы. FULL OUTER JOIN выдаёт все записи из двух таблиц, заполняя недостающие величины NULL.

CROSS JOIN формирует декартово произведение таблиц, комбинируя каждую запись первой таблицы с каждой записью второй. Субзапросы позволяют использовать итог одного инструкции внутри иного. Изучение admiral x и осознание принципов связывания таблиц увеличивает возможности деятельности с admiral-x в составных базах данных.

Характерные проблемы, которые решают с посредством SQL

Создание сводок образует значительную порцию работы с базами данных. Аналитики добывают сведения о сделках, клиентах и финансовых метриках за определённые периоды. Инструкции агрегируют информацию и классифицируют итоги по классам для предоставления менеджменту.

Обнаружение дубликатов способствует сохранять качество данных в системе. Инструкции выявляют повторяющиеся записи по ключевым полям: email, телефон или уникальный номер. Выявление дублей обеспечивает возможность очистить базу и исключить ошибки.

Передача сведений между структурами нуждается извлечения сведений из одной базы и загрузки в иную. SQL обеспечивает выгрузку строк в требуемом формате и загрузку информации с трансформацией архитектуры.

Определение аналитических параметров производится через суммирующие операции и консолидацию информации. Эксперты определяют средний счёт клиента, коэффициент воронки продаж и динамику расширения клиентской базы.

Управление полномочиями подключения ограничивает варианты клиентов по взаимодействия с сведениями. Управляющие устанавливают права на просмотр, корректировку и стирание информации для отличающихся ролей. Практическое использование адмирал х покрывает большой спектр вопросов от анализа до обслуживания платформ.

Промахи, которых стоит избегать в начале деятельности

Отсутствие критерия WHERE при обновлении или устранении строк влечёт к корректировке всех элементов в таблице. Неопытные упускают указать условие выборки и ошибочно изменяют информацию, которые должны сохраниться нетронутыми. Перед запуском команд UPDATE и DELETE требуется проверить параметр выборки.

Пренебрежение индексов снижает скорость исполнение команд к объёмным таблицам. Поиск без индексов заставляет систему просматривать все строки по порядку. Формирование индексов для регулярно используемых колонок ускоряет операции отбора сведений в десятки раз.

Распространённые неточности новичков работников охватывают:

  • Использование SELECT * взамен указания требуемых колонок, что повышает нагрузку на систему
  • Отсутствие резервного дублирования перед массовыми корректировками информации
  • Содержание паролей и конфиденциальной информации в явном формате
  • Игнорирование правил согласованности при создании таблиц

Ошибочное задействование типов данных влечёт к избыточному расходу дискового пространства. Выбор текстового поля значительного размера для сохранения коротких значений нерационален. Каждый вид данных обладает оптимальную область применения и правила.

Пренебрежение транзакциями при реализации взаимосвязанных операций нарушает целостность данных. Если одна из инструкций завершается неточностью, ранние модификации сохраняются в базе. Транзакции гарантируют целостность реализации набора операций.

Копирование запросов без знания логики деятельности вызывает трудности при корректировке скрипта. Изучение admiral-x предполагает вдумчивого способа и анализа итогов выполнения инструкций.

Bir yanıt yazın

E-posta adresiniz yayınl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ir